温馨提示×

# insert

insert语句能自动生成ID吗

小樊
95
2024-06-27 16:11:23

在MySQL数据库中,可以通过自增主键(AUTO_INCREMENT)来实现自动生成ID的功能。当插入一条新记录时,不需要手动指定ID值,数据库会自动分配一个唯一的ID值给新记录。下面是一个示例的in...

0

insert语句使用时的注意事项

小樊
83
2024-06-27 16:10:26

在使用insert语句时,需要注意以下事项: 1. 检查表结构:确保insert语句中的字段名称和值与表结构中的字段名称和类型匹配。如果字段名称或类型不匹配,会导致插入失败或数据错误。 2. 检查...

0

insert语句的安全性如何提高

小樊
82
2024-06-27 16:09:19

insert语句的安全性可以通过以下方法提高: 1. 使用参数化查询:使用参数化查询可以防止SQL注入攻击。参数化查询会将用户输入的数据作为参数传递给数据库,而不是直接拼接在SQL语句中。 2. ...

0

insert语句是否支持子查询

小樊
92
2024-06-27 16:07:18

是的,INSERT语句可以支持子查询。在INSERT语句中,可以使用子查询来从其他表中检索数据并插入到目标表中。例如: ```sql INSERT INTO table1 (column1, col...

0

insert语句如何实现条件插入

小樊
99
2024-06-27 16:06:19

您可以使用INSERT INTO ... SELECT语句来实现条件插入。例如,假设您有一个名为table1的表,您想将满足某些条件的行插入到另一个名为table2的表中,您可以执行以下语句: ``...

0

insert语句的执行顺序是什么

小樊
83
2024-06-27 16:05:20

插入(Insert)语句的执行顺序通常遵循以下步骤: 1. 执行插入语句时,首先检查插入的数据是否符合表的约束条件,如主键、唯一键、外键等约束。 2. 如果数据符合约束条件,则将数据插入表中。 3....

0

insert语句如何避免重复记录

小樊
89
2024-06-27 16:04:18

1. 在插入数据之前,可以先查询数据库中是否已经存在相同的记录,如果存在则不插入。 2. 在数据库中设置唯一约束(Unique Constraint)或者主键(Primary Key),这样在插入数...

0

insert语句可以插入NULL值吗

小樊
99
2024-06-27 16:02:17

是的,INSERT语句可以插入NULL值。如果某个列允许存储NULL值,并且在INSERT语句中没有为该列指定值,则该列将被插入为NULL值。例如: ```sql INSERT INTO table...

0

insert语句与update区别在哪

小樊
86
2024-06-27 16:01:20

Insert语句用于向数据库表中插入新的记录,如果数据库表中已经存在相同的记录,则会插入失败并抛出错误。而Update语句用于更新数据库表中已经存在的记录,如果数据库表中不存在相同的记录,则会更新失败...

0

insert语句批量插入数据方法

小樊
142
2024-06-27 16:00:27

在SQL中,可以使用INSERT INTO语句来批量插入数据。以下是一种常见的方法: ```sql INSERT INTO table_name (column1, column2, column3...

0